Partager via


Modale et boîtes de dialogue non modale

Vous pouvez utiliser la classe CDialog pour gérer deux types de boîtes de dialogue :

  • Boîtes de dialogue modales, qui nécessitent l'utilisateur pour répondre avant de poursuivre le programme

  • Les boîtes de dialogue non modales, qui restent à l'écran et sont disponibles à tout moment mais permettent d'autres activités de la part de l'utilisateur

La modification et les procédures de ressource pour créer un modèle de la boîte de dialogue sont les mêmes pour les boîtes de dialogue modale et non modales.

Créer d'une boîte de dialogue pour votre application requiert des étapes suivantes :

  1. Utilisez , l'éditeur de boîtes de dialogue pour concevoir la boîte de dialogue et créer la ressource modèle de la boîte de dialogue.

  2. Créer une boîte de dialogue

  3. Connectez les contrôles de ressources boîte de dialogue aux gestionnaires de messages dans la classe de la boîte de dialogue.

  4. Ajouter des membres de données associés aux contrôles de la boîte de dialogue et spécifier les boîtes de dialogue d'échange de données xwz5tb1x(v=vs.120).md et boîtes de dialogue de validation des données k48w5b23(v=vs.120).md pour les contrôles.

Voir aussi

Concepts

boîtes de dialogue

cycle de vie d'une boîte de dialogue